Afzal Gunj is one of the old suburbs in Hyderabad, close to river Musi

Commercial area

There are many shops which cater to all the needs of the people. Also there is an old shop called as Munnalal Dawasaaz.

There is a popular Irani hotel here called as Television Cafe.

Accessibility

The APSRTC has a major bus hub in this area and connects Afzal Gunj with all parts of the city and some of the suburban villages.

The domestic and international airport, Hyderabad Airport, is located north of the place about 35 km from Afzal Gunj.
